Font Size: a A A

Research And Design Of Enum Server - Integration Of Internet And Communications Networks

Posted on:2010-04-12Degree:MasterType:Thesis
Country:ChinaCandidate:S Y FengFull Text:PDF
GTID:2208360275483022Subject:Computer system architecture
Abstract/Summary:PDF Full Text Request
With the continuous progress of human society,information technology has made rapid advances and has brought a qualitative leap to people's life. In the information industry development process,the biggest achievements are the telephony-based communication network technology invented in the nineteenth century and Internet technologies born in the last century. Now, the two different networks to the human society have brought great changes, and they have become an indispensable part of the society. But the Internet and communication network have been both independent of each other because of various reasons. With the development of today's information society and people's increasing demand, network integration has become the future trend.ENUM technology has been developed from the people's hope that the communication is not bound by networks separation. As the key of network integration of Internet and the communication network, it represents the mean of telephone number mapping. That is, it creates the map relation between the key resource telephone number in communication network and Internet domain name address, and proposed a DNS query program based on this mapping to eliminate the barriers between the Internet and communication network, so ENUM technology achieves mutual contact to promote the integration of the two networks.This thesis first makes a study for ENUM technology, and introduces basic ENUM concept and functions to be achieved. The functions include telephone number mapping, ENUM query and NAPTR resource record process mechanism. And then this thesis describes in detail the role of ENUM technology in network integration. The thesis first introduces the place of ENUM servers in network system, and then describes work process and application in network system of ENUM technology.Moreove, the thesis analyses and compares the network server software sevice model technology. First it introduces common concurrent models, and then analyses the network I/O technology and disk I/O technology. The analysis is very meaningful to design a high performance ENUM server latter. Then, the thesis designs and implements an ENUM server, which should be deplayed in communication network and has a performance requirement. First the thesis introduces the server system architecture. The server has three modules including ENUM query module, ERH external query module and database module. Moreover, the thesis describes the process framework, data model and data flow of the server and then describes each module in detail. In addition, the thesis proposed some possible extended business or functions of ENUM server in future.Finally, the thesis makes a performance analysis for the designed server. And then a performance test verifies the performance requirement of the server.
Keywords/Search Tags:network integration, ENUM, telephone number mapping, network server
PDF Full Text Request
Related items